Tufts University vs California College of the Arts
Medford, MA — San Francisco, CA
| Metric | Tufts University Medford, MA | California College of the Arts San Francisco, CA |
|---|---|---|
| Location | Medford, MA | San Francisco, CA |
| Type | Private Nonprofit | Private Nonprofit |
| Total Enrollment | 7,061 | 990 |
| Acceptance Rate | 11.5% | 91.1% |
| SAT Average | 1,513 | — |
| In-State Tuition | $70,704 | $60,226 |
| Out-of-State Tuition | $70,704 | $60,226 |
| Avg Net Price | $39,998 | $53,909 |
| Median Debt at Graduation | $16,250 | $27,000 |
| 4-Year Graduation Rate | 93.4% | 62.3% |
| Retention Rate | 95.5% | 86.7% |
| Median Earnings (6 yr) | $68,337 | $38,308 |
| Median Earnings (10 yr) | $83,214 | $49,414 |

Frequently Asked Questions
How do Tufts University and California College of the Arts compare?▼
Tufts University (Medford, MA) has an acceptance rate of 11.5%, in-state tuition of $70,704, and median 10-year earnings of $83,214. California College of the Arts (San Francisco, CA) has an acceptance rate of 91.1%, in-state tuition of $60,226, and median 10-year earnings of $49,414.
Which school has higher graduate earnings, Tufts University or California College of the Arts?▼
Tufts University graduates earn more at 10 years out, with a median of $83,214 vs $49,414.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ard.
Which school is more affordable, Tufts University or California College of the Arts?▼
Based on average net price (after grants and scholarships), Tufts University is the more affordable option at $39,998 per year versus $53,909.
Which school has a better 4-year graduation rate?▼
Tufts University has the higher 4-year graduation rate: 93.4% vs 62.3%.
